Public Transport
From Surfers Paradise, walk to the Surfers Paradise Light Rail Station. Take the G:link light rail towards Helensvale and get off at Helensvale Station. From Helensvale, transfer to bus Route 753 towards Carrara. Get off at the Carrara Sports and Leisure Centre. From there, it's a short walk to Coral Reef, located at Carrara QLD 4211. A single fare on the G:link is around $4. The bus fare will be a few dollars as well.
Taxi/Ride-Share
From central Surfers Paradise, a taxi or ride-share to Carrara QLD 4211 will cost approximately $30-40 and take around 20-30 minutes, depending on traffic. Drop-off is typically near the Carrara Sports and Leisure Centre, from where it is a short walk to the Coral Reef.
